如何生成一模一样的比特币钱包及其风险分析
引言
比特币作为一种去中心化的数字货币,其钱包的生成和管理对用户至关重要。由于比特币的特性,生成一模一样的比特币钱包是一个技术性强且充满风险的操作。本文将详细分析如何生成一模一样的比特币钱包,探讨其可能带来的风险与挑战,并解答一些常见问题。
比特币钱包的基本概念
比特币钱包是一种软件程序或硬件设备,用于存储、发送和接收比特币。钱包保存着用户的私钥和公钥,私钥是用户进行交易时必须保密的关键信息,而公钥则可以公开分享,以便其他人向用户发送比特币。钱包的种类多样,包括热钱包、冷钱包、硬件钱包和纸钱包等,不同类型的钱包在安全性和使用便捷性上有所差异。
一模一样钱包的生成原理
生成一模一样的比特币钱包,首先需要理解其私钥、地址与公钥之间的关系。比特币使用椭圆曲线加密(ECDSA)生成一对公私钥,私钥用于签署交易,而公钥用于生成比特币地址。要生成一模一样的钱包,首先需要相同的随机数种子,利用该种子生成的私钥必然是相同的,从而导致生成相同的公钥和比特币地址。
生成一模一样钱包的步骤
1. **选择随机数种子:** 首先,选择一个固定的随机数种子。这是生成私钥的基础,任何基于同一随机数种子的操作都会得到相同的私钥。
2. **生成私钥:** 运用加密算法(例如ECDSA)利用选定的随机数种子生成私钥。
3. **生成公钥:** 使用私钥生成公钥,这个过程是公开的,因此可以与他人共享。
4. **生成比特币地址:** 将公钥经过哈希处理,最终得到可用于接收比特币的地址。
通过以上步骤,即可生成一模一样的比特币钱包。然而,值得注意的是,固定的随机数种子将大大降低钱包的安全性。
生成相同钱包的风险
生成一模一样的比特币钱包本质上意味着降低安全性,进而带来严重的风险:
1. **私钥泄漏风险:** 如果私人种子被他人获取,将会导致私钥和钱包地址的安全受到威胁。如果攻击者掌握了私钥,则可以劫取钱包内的所有比特币。
2. **重复交易** 多台设备使用相同钱包进行交易时,可能导致交易冲突和混淆,造成资金损失。
3. **风险转移:** 一旦钱包被黑客攻击至,相同的私钥有可能会导致所有使用此钱包的用户全部受到影响。
4. **法律风险:** 模仿其他用户的比特币钱包也许会涉及到法律诉讼问题。
常见问题解答
如何避免生成一模一样的比特币钱包?
在生成比特币钱包时,选择高质量的随机数生成器非常重要。尽量避免使用固定的种子,使用真正随机生成数的方法,如硬件随机数生成器。此外,定期更换钱包的私钥,也能显著降低安全风险。可采用多种加密方法,增加生成的私钥的复杂性,使其更难被破解。
如果我不小心生成了相同的钱包会发生什么?
若不小心生成了相同的钱包,当前在该地址内的比特币将可能面临被偷取的风险。若这些地址被公开,另外有用户使用了这个相同的私钥,就会导致这些比特币随时被他人转移。同时,这个钱包的交易记录也可能互相混淆,给用户带来不必要的损失与追索。
如何安全地存储我的比特币钱包?
比特币钱包的安全存储至关重要。应选择冷钱包(如硬件钱包或纸钱包)作为长期存储的解决方案。对于热钱包,确保使用强密码,并开启双重认证。此外,务必定期备份钱包数据,并将备份数据存放在安全的地方。避免在不安全的设备上进行交易或对钱包进行操作,也可以减少安全风险。
比特币钱包之间的主要区别是什么?
比特币钱包有多种类型,主要包括热钱包、冷钱包、硬件钱包和纸钱包:
1. **热钱包:** 在线存储,便于快速交易,适合频繁使用者,但安全性较低。
2. **冷钱包:** 离线存储,非常安全,适合长期存储。
3. **硬件钱包:** 专门的设备,安全性极高,但需购买,使用上可能不如软件钱包便捷。
4. **纸钱包:** 将私钥和公钥以纸张形式记录,无需网络,但保存不当则有丢失和盗用风险。
如何检测钱包的安全性?
检验钱包安全性主要通过多种方式:
1. **检查钱包的开发团队和社区活跃度:** 优良的社区和开发者支持可提升钱包的安全性。
2. **查看钱包的安全审计报告:** 有些钱包会定期进行安全审计,提供透明的信息以增强用户安全感。
3. **评估钱包的安全特性:** 如双重认证、加密算法强度及用户反馈等。
针对每一方面进行深入了解,有助于选择一个安全可靠的比特币钱包。
总结
生成一模一样的比特币钱包在技术上是可行的,但伴随着极大的风险。用户在使用和生成比特币钱包时,需谨慎对待私钥和随机数种子的管理,以保证资产的安全。同时,了解不同类型钱包的特点与风险,将帮助用户选择最适合的比特币管理方案。在这个数字资产时代,安全意识显得尤为重要。